Money and research have been going toward laboratory grown meat products of beef burger, pork, and fish where cell samples are taken from creatures to reproduce their stem cells around a billion fold with expectations of possible mass production in 10 years or more with the first burgers available this year at around 300,000 dollars cost per burger. After the billion fold increase of the stem cells, a few meat tissue cells are added to these to grow meat. The stem cells reproduce quickly and 33 cell divisions from one cell yields over 1.428 billion cells.
